Question
"No consideration,No contract" Explain with exception.

Answer
Consideration:-
Consideration for a particular promise exists where some 
right, interest, profit or benefit accrues (or will accrue) 
to the promisor as a direct result of some forbearance, 
detriment, loss or responsibility that has been given, 
suffered or undertaken by the promisee. The consideration 
must be executory or executed, but not past. Consideration 
is executoryConsideration can be anything of value (such as 
an item or service), which each party to a legally-binding 
contract must agree to exchange if the contract is to be 
valid. If only one party offers consideration, the 
agreement is not legally a binding contract. In its 
traditional form, consideration is expressed as the 
requirement that in order for parties to be able to enforce 
a promise, they must have given something for it (quid pro 
quo): something must be given or promised in exchange or 
return for the promise.

contract:-
A contract is an exchange of promises between two or more 
parties to do or refrain from doing an act which is 
enforceable in a court of law. It is where an unqualified 
offer meets a qualified acceptance and the parties reach 
Consensus In Idem. The parties must have the necessary 
capacity to contract and the contract must not be either 
trifling, indeterminate, impossible or illegal.
